The Administrative Director of Cardiology Services provides strategic and operational leadership for all cardiology services, including the Cardiac Cath Lab, Pre/Post Holding Units, Stress Lab, Cardiac Ultrasound, Vascular Lab, and associated staff. This position is responsible for ensuring high-quality patient care, managing departmental resources efficiently, and maintaining compliance with corporate, hospital, and regulatory standards. The Director fosters a collaborative environment with physicians, clinical staff, and other healthcare providers to enhance patient outcomes, operational efficiency, and customer satisfaction.
Essential Functions
- Provides strategic direction for all Cardiology Services, ensuring programs, clinical practices, and scope of services align with organizational objectives and evidence-based standards of care.
- Oversees the integration of innovative practices and technologies to enhance patient outcomes, operational efficiency, and patient satisfaction.
- Assesses patient acuity and departmental needs to allocate resources effectively, including staffing adjustments, equipment purchases, and technology upgrades.
- Collaborates with physicians, nursing leadership, ancillary staff, and discharge planners to coordinate patient care and optimize service delivery across the continuum of care.
- Serves as a clinical and operational resource to staff, promoting professional development, evaluating competencies, and modeling best practices in cardiology services.
- Partners with hospital and corporate leadership to evaluate financial performance, analyze variances, and develop strategies to meet budgetary goals while supporting high-quality patient care.
- Participates in hospital-wide strategic planning and cross-departmental initiatives to support organizational growth and patient care excellence.
